The North Carolina Symphony launches its 2015 Rex Healthcare Summerfest Series at Cary's Booth Amphitheatre today, May 23, at 7:30 p.m., with a concert program that features pianist Timo Andres performing Gershwin's incomparable Rhapsody in Blue, the orchestra's performance of Dvo?ak's New World Symphony, and other works by Copland and Sousa that feature "citizen musicians" as they join the orchestra.

The American Theatre Wing and the Village Voice just presented the winners of the 60th Annual OBIE Awards. The Public Theater's Hamilton by Lin-Manuel Miranda (including special citations for Andy Blankenbuehler, Thomas Kail, and Alex Lacamoire) received the OBIE Award for Best New American Theatre Work, which is accompanied by a $1,000 check. The Signature Theatre's Founding Artistic Director James Houghton received the OBIE Award for Sustained Achievement. The Awards were hosted by OBIE Award-winning actress Lea DeLaria ('Orange is the New Black'). BroadwayWorld brings you photos from the winners room below!
